Product overview

The Fritsch Test Sieve, 100 x 40 mm with a mesh size of 315 µm, is made from high-quality stainless steel and conforms to ISO 3310-1 standards. This sieve is designed for efficient particle size analysis and sample preparation in laboratory environments. With its durable stainless steel construction, it ensures long-lasting performance and resistance to corrosion, making it ideal for both dry and wet sieving applications.

Product Specifications

  • HS Code #84799070
  • Ø100 mm
  • Height40 mm
  • MaterialStainless steel
  • Mesh size0.315 mm
  • UNSPSC41105003
